Tuesday Evenings .  Run Rice area parking garages or the stadium withEd_Rod.  Meet at 6:00 PM and park here:http://www.bcrr.org/monmap.pdf 

Wednesday Mornings . The fun starts at 5:30 am on Wednesday at Sugar Hill and Pine Shadows (one block east of Tanglewood; from 610 take Woodway, turn left on Sage and pull into the parking lot at St. Martin's Church (on the left).  Distances and workout vary from week to week. All paces welcome.

Wednesday Evening at Valhalla ...... We meet at Rice University for Sprints and Spirits. The group meets at 5:45 pm for a tempo run  at 6:00 pm of  5-7 miles. All levels are welcome. And the best part is the cheap beer at Valhalla afterwards.  For a detailed map on where we meet and park:http://www.bcrr.org/wedmap.pdf

Sunday Morning Long Run
...  Regular Long Run. We meet at the 0 marker at Memorial Park (in front of the Tennis Center on the cinder trail) and leave at 6:30 am sharp. Distance is 10 to 12 to 20 miles. Breakfast afterwards at a nearby restaurant. For more info on hooking up with this group, call John Phillips at 713.467.0572 or just be there before 6:30 and start running with us.  John Phillips
